Top 10 Exotic Beaches in Europe
104764
Reasons to Visit Spello Village in Italy
Nestled in the heart of the picturesque region of Umbria, Italy, lies the enchanting village of Spello—a hidden gem waiting to be discovered by avid travelers seeking authentic Italian experiences.